Analysis
The most recent figure for gross enrolment ratio for tertiary education, male in Bangladesh is 27.0%, measured in 2024.
That represents a change of down 3.8% on the previous year and up 70.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ross enrolment ratio for tertiary education, male in Bangladesh peaked at 28.3% in 2021 and was at its lowest, 3.4%, in 1978.
That places Bangladesh 110th out of 189 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Gross enrolment ratio for tertiary education, male in Bangladesh, year by year
| Year | % |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1970 | 3.5% | — |
| 1972 | 3.8% | +7.6% |
| 1974 | 4.7% | +24.8% |
| 1976 | 3.7% | -21.7% |
| 1977 | 4.1% | +10.0% |
| 1978 | 3.4% | -17.2% |
| 1979 | 5.0% | +47.3% |
| 1980 | 5.0% | +1.2% |
| 1981 | 5.0% | -0.1% |
| 1982 | 5.6% | +12.4% |
| 1983 | 7.4% | +31.2% |
| 1984 | 8.2% | +11.0% |
| 1985 | 8.4% | +1.8% |
| 1986 | 8.2% | -1.5% |
| 1987 | 7.3% | -11.8% |
| 1988 | 6.5% | -11.1% |
| 1989 | 6.4% | -1.0% |
| 1990 | 7.3% | +14.6% |
| 1999 | 7.1% | -2.3% |
| 2000 | 7.1% | -0.7% |
| 2001 | 8.2% | +15.3% |
| 2002 | 8.1% | -1.5% |
| 2003 | 8.2% | +1.3% |
| 2004 | 7.6% | -6.6% |
| 2005 | 8.2% | +7.2% |
| 2006 | 9.2% | +12.7% |
| 2007 | 10.0% | +8.1% |
| 2008 | 11.2% | +12.0% |
| 2009 | 13.2% | +18.1% |
| 2011 | 15.7% | +19.4% |
| 2012 | 15.7% | -0.4% |
| 2013 | 15.7% | +0.2% |
| 2014 | 15.8% | +0.4% |
| 2015 | 18.4% | +16.4% |
| 2016 | 20.7% | +12.9% |
| 2017 | 22.0% | +6.2% |
| 2018 | 23.6% | +7.2% |
| 2019 | 27.7% | +17.4% |
| 2020 | 26.8% | -3.4% |
| 2021 | 28.3% | +5.8% |
| 2022 | 27.9% | -1.7% |
| 2023 | 28.0% | +0.6% |
| 2024 | 27.0% | -3.9% |
